The opportunity:

The Land Ceptor System of Systems organisation is growing fast in order to support delivery of export contracts and evolution of the product to enhance the capabilities for our customers. As a System of Systems engineer your primary objective is to support the functional integration of the Land Ceptor product into a wider Ground Based Air Defence Weapon System context.

As a System of System Engineer you will support (or lead dependant on experience) across a number of work streams including:

  • Working with the customer to define System of Systems Requirements, including evolution paths for future development.
  • Working with the customer to define System of Systems architecture and use-cases to support development and evolution of system requirements.
  • Defining System of Systems integration requirements and verification plans.
  • Conducting design and technical reviews both internally and in conjunction with the customer.
  • Work collaboratively within a multidisciplinary team on technical issues, queries and conflict resolution including coordinating responses to and from the customer and industrial partners.

We are looking for flexible and motivated candidates to work collaboratively with our customers, industry partners and internal project teams to develop solutions for existing and future programmes. The work is varied, providing you with a unique opportunity to develop a wider awareness of multiple engineering disciplines alongside contributing to critical programme delivery in the form of System architectural design and requirements definition.
